Well I got a 626 for my winter car. It is the 91 2.2 It will not start has been hit in the front. I checked everything. It has spark, gas, getting good compression? just will not start. I don;t want to drop to much money into this car due to it only being a winter car. any help would be great

Sounds like you have a bad timing belt. If your getting fuel,ignition and compression the only thing
left is the the belt.
Owe one thing you can check is the reluctor could be
installed backwards on your distributor. The ramp side
should lead the direction it's turning. It'll hardly
run with this thing backwards.

Oh yes the timming belt wears and stops the engine from running but still cranks BULL!@#$!!! the timming belt wears then snaps, then a valve hits a piston!! if your engine cranks and compression is good the valves must be opening and closing which means the belt is usable. recomended replacement every 100,000km as to avoid breakage and a buggered engine!! a friend done 202,000 in his 323 before first replacement!!
